Utah Payroll Employment By County for All Federal Government Business Establishments in May, 2019
Updated on October 9, 2022.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in May, 2019, Utah added 706 number of jobs to all federal government business establishments. Among Utah counties, Salt Lake added the highest number of jobs (103), followed by Davis (93), and Washington (64).
